As a pilot who initially flew small planes, then flew US Army helicopters for twenty years, I encourage and commend someone wanting to aviate. However, keep in mind that it is not like riding a bicycle or driving a car. Proficiency as a pilot is a skill and ability gained through practice after practice, constantly and continuously. Often you see aircraft practicing touch & go's. Soaring with delight above the landscape, challenging the grip of gravity is the easy part. Take-offs, landings, and emergency procedures are a different realm and require study, thought, and lots of practice. Rules, regulations, and helpful knowledge are gained and maintained through constant study, update, and implementation.
